Gravity can become strong at the TeV scale in the theory of extra dimensions. An effective Lagrangian can be used to describe the gravitational interactions below a cut-off scale. In this work, we study the associated production of the gravitons with a $Z$ boson or a photon at $e^+ e^-$ colliders of energies of LEPII to the Next Linear Colliders (NLC) ($\sqrt{s}=0.25-1.5$ TeV) and calculate the sensitivity to the new interactions. We also obtain the limit on the cut-off scale using the present data from LEPII.
